Auto dealers provide a variety of solutions associated with the acquiring and marketing of automobiles. Among their major features is to serve as intermediaries (or intermediaries) between automobile producers and customers, purchasing lorries directly from the manufacturer and then selling them to customers at a markup. Additionally, they frequently supply financing choices for buyers and will certainly assist with the trade-in or sale of a client's old car.


Finally, the management division handles tasks such as scheduling consultations and handling consumer records. Together, these divisions function to offer a smooth experience for cars and truck customers.
